Major Curriculum Requirements
MAJOR: ENVIROMENTAL SCIENCE and POLICY
HOURS
Core Curriculum Requirements
55-62
Technical Requirements
17-18*
BIO 105 Principles of Biology
4
ECO 122 Microeconomics
3
POL 120 American Government
3
Choose one from the following:
4
MAT 129 Pre-Calculus
MAT 165 Calculus
Choose one from the following:
3-4
MAT 215 Applied Statistics
POL 215 Statistics for Political & Social Sciences
Major Requirements
54-56*
BIO 106 Principles of Biology
4
BIO 310 Ecology
4
ECO 262 Economics of the Environment
3
EAR 110 Physical Geology
3
ENV 120 Intro to Environmental Science & Policy
4
ENV 200 Environmental Seminar
3
ENV 231 Environmental Policy
3
ENV 250 Intro to GIS
3
ENV 250L Intro to GIS Lab
1
ENV 325 Environmental Monitoring
4
PHI 251 Environmental Ethics
3
Choose one from the following:
4-6
ENV 470 Problems in Environmental Science & Policy
ENV 498 Senior Honors research and
ENV 499 Senior Honors Thesis
Choose one from the following:
3
POL 250 Public Administration
POL 351 Public Policy
Choose 12 credits from one of the following tracks:
Policy Track:
ECO 322 Government and Business
ECO 424 Economic Development
ENV 210 Environmental Education I
ENV 215 Environmental Education II
HES 430 Public Health
POL 222 State and Local Government
POL 427 Congress & the Policymaking Process
SOC 200 Social Problems
SOC 345 Global Inequality
SOC 379 Environment & Society
Science Track:
BIO 212 Biology of Microorganisms
BIO 237 Biodiversity
BIO 260 Field Biology
BIO 270 Systematic Biology
CHE 103 General Chemistry & Qualitative Analysis I
CHE 103L General Chemistry Laboratory I
CHE 104 General Chemistry & Qualitative Analysis II
CHE 104L General Chemistry Laboratory II
CHE 201 Organic Chemistry I & lab
CHE 202 Organic Chemistry II & lab
EAR 210 Climate & Meteorology
EAR 240 Map Construct & Read
ENV 210 Environmental Education I
ENV 215 Environmental Education II
12
Choose one from the following:
PHY 121 General Physics I
PHY 211 Analytical Physics II
Choose one from the following:
PHY 122 General Physics I
PHY 212 Analytical Physics II
* On occasion, technical and/or program requirements may also meet specific core curriculum requirements. Please
confer with your program advisor to determine which courses, if any, may be counted accordingly.
Please note: The courses above are intended to represent the most current technical and major requirements for this
program. The University Catalog, however, is the ultimate and final authority for all degree-related requirements.
Current students should follow the curriculum requirements stated in the University Catalog under the academic year
they matriculated to Lenoir-Rhyne, which may be different than the list above. Additionally, all undergraduate degree
programs at LR require a minimum of 128 earned credit hours. If, in combination, the core, technical, and program
requirements do not culminate in at least 128 hours, additional credits must be earned to achieve 128 hours. These
credits may be general electives, or a student may complete a minor or additional major. Please refer to the University
Catalog for a complete listing of all graduation requirements and/or confer with your Academic Advisor.
